‘Trees of Orange County' on exhibit

| 30 Sep 2011 | 08:42

GOSHEN — The Executive Suite Gallery in the Orange County Government Center is hosting the Orange County Citizens Foundation’s 2010 Cultural Exhibit focusing on the Trees of Orange County through Jan. 6, 2011. The exhibit includes an interesting array of work by notable local artists such as Pat Mohr, Nick Zungoli and Catherine DeMaio and informational pieces that represent regional trees and their uses. “Over the past several decades, Orange County and the nation have lost a number of tree species due to disease, changes in the environment and development,” said Nancy Proyect, president of the Orange County Citizens Foundation. “By developing relationships with trees in their local communities, we hope large numbers of people will begin to recognize the importance of healthy trees and responsible development to our future.” The exhibit is located in the Orange County Government Center on the third floor at 255 Main St. in Goshen, and is open to the public during business hours.
